Sonam Wangchuk ends fast after Centre's assurance
Activist Sonam Wangchuk ended his hunger strike after government assurances. The Centre promised no legal action against peacefully protesting students. This breakthrough resolved the nearly four-week standoff over exam leak protests. Union ministers met Wangchuk, offering him juice to formally end his fast. Wangchuk had begun his protest on June 28 in solidarity with students.
